As an alternative to the HP support site, you should be able to get the correct drivers from Windows Update. Using the devices and Printers' Add Printer, I was able to successfully add the HP 5 p to a system of Windows 7 Home Premium 64-bit.

  1. Click Start or press on the then select devices and printers from the list on the right. When thedevices and printers windows opens and fills, click Add a printer among control options at the top.
  2. To open the Add Printer window, first select Add a local printer. Then select a port and click Next.
  3. In the next window, first click on the Windows Update button and wait a few minutes until the list is filled again. It will look like nothing is happening, but it's work. Once the lists are updated, select HP for the manufacturer and the HP LaserJet 5 p Printers.
  4. When you click Next must install the printer driver and you'll end up with the final test print screen.
                                           

FWIW, I created the test to aid installation FILE: (print to file) as the port. Once the driver is installed in the system, plug any 5 p with a USB connection should install instantly using existing drivers.

  • LaserJet P2015 PCL6: Problem with LJ P2015 PCL6 x 86 drivers for x 64 print server

    Hello, I am trying to add x 86 additional drivers for the print 2008R2 server, but seems the downloaded packages 'LJP2015-pcl6-pnp-win32-it' or 'ljp2015pcl6vista2k2008xp2003' does not contain the driver corrette (hppaew04.inf, hppcp504.inf) Server report "the specified location contains no pilot for the required processor architecture". I have to find a solution because some users have windows xp clients and to do printer. Thanks in advance Davide

    Resolved using an unusual way.

    The only driver for WinXP is was not aligned with the x 64 version, so it is not possible to install directly to the print server.

    I solved this way:

    install a printer as local device on the Windows XP client.

    the customer opened \\PRINT_SERVER\devices and printers

    right click on the printer

    at this point, begin the installation of the driver on the client, using the x 86 driver (not the UPD, but the native driver).

    On the server are now available for both x 64 and x 86 native printer driver.

    This workaround is only for the win2008 R2 on previous versions of Windows Server that this problem is not present.

  • where can I get drivers for Epson Stylus printer c760 for windows7

    According to the website of compatibility, I should be able to use this printer on my new computer, but so far I have had no luck

    Epson Stylus c760 support and driver info:
    http://www.Epson.com/cgi-bin/store/support/supDetail.jsp?OID=14416

    On the Epson website:

    Description: Printer drivers Windows 7 for this model are included in the Windows 7 operating system. Follow the instructions below to install the printer Windows 7 driver.

    1. Make sure that your computer is connected to the Internet.
    2. Click on , and then select devices and printers.
    3. Select Add a printer.
    4. Select Add a local printer or Add a network, wireless or Bluetooth printer.
    5. Choose your printer port.
    6. Click on Windows Update and wait for updating the list of printers. The update may take a few minutes.
    7. Select EPSON as the manufacturer, then scroll through the list of printers and select your printer. Follow the on-screen instructions to complete the driver installation.

    Supported systems: Windows 7 32 - bit, Windows 7 64 bit
